The mission of the Veterans History Project of the American Folklife Center is to collect, preserve, and make accessible the personal accounts of American war veterans so that future generations may hear directly from veterans and better understand the realities of war.

Purpose of Veterans History Project:

  • Collects, preserve and makes accessible personal war accounts for future generations.
  • Stories collected through audio-video tape interviews, letters, postcards, memoirs, journals, etc.

Veteran Profiles for United States Veterans from:

  • World War I (1914-1920)
  • World War ll (1938-1945)
  • Korean War (1950-1955)
  • Vietnam War (1961-1975)
  • Persian Gulf War (1990-1995)
  • Iraq-Afghanistan (2001- present)

Started by US Congress:

  • Veteran History Project was created by United States Congress in 2000
  • October 27, 2000 President Bill Clinton signed VA Project into law
